Honey Chili Crunch Chicken Wrap (Printable)

Vibrant wrap with pan-seared chicken, honey chili crisp sauce, and fresh crunchy vegetables in a soft tortilla.

# Required Ingredients:

→ Chicken

01 - 2 boneless, skinless chicken breasts (14 oz), thinly sliced
02 - 1 tablespoon olive oil
03 - 1/2 teaspoon salt
04 - 1/4 teaspoon ground black pepper
05 - 1/2 teaspoon smoked paprika

→ Honey Chili Crisp Sauce

06 - 3 tablespoons honey
07 - 2 tablespoons chili crisp
08 - 1 tablespoon soy sauce
09 - 1 teaspoon rice vinegar

→ Wrap Assembly

10 - 4 large flour tortillas (10-inch)
11 - 2 cups chopped romaine or iceberg lettuce
12 - 1 cup thinly sliced cucumber
13 - 1/2 cup shredded carrot
14 - 1/4 cup thinly sliced scallions
15 - 2 tablespoons mayonnaise

# Preparation Steps:

01 - Season sliced chicken breasts evenly with salt, pepper, and smoked paprika.
02 - Heat olive oil in a large skillet over medium-high heat. Add seasoned chicken and sauté for 6-7 minutes, stirring occasionally, until golden brown and cooked through. Remove from heat and set aside.
03 - Whisk together honey, chili crisp, soy sauce, and rice vinegar in a small bowl until well combined.
04 - Toss warm cooked chicken with prepared sauce until evenly coated.
05 - Warm tortillas briefly in a dry skillet or microwave to achieve pliability.
06 - Lay each tortilla flat. Spread thin layer of mayonnaise down the center if desired. Layer with lettuce, cucumber, carrot, and scallions. Top with one-quarter of honey chili chicken.
07 - Roll each tortilla tightly, folding in the sides as you progress, to form a secure wrap.
08 - Slice each wrap in half and serve immediately.

02 -
  • Dont skip warming the tortillas—cold tortillas crack and tear when you try to roll them
  • The sauce thickens as it cools, so toss the chicken immediately while its still hot
  • Roll wraps right before serving, or the lettuce will make everything soggy
03 -
  • Slice all your vegetables while the chicken cooks for maximum efficiency
  • If sauce seems too thick, add a teaspoon of warm water to loosen it
  • Use a sharp knife to slice wraps cleanly without crushing the fillings
